…………….long delay in filing an application under Section 124 of the Trademarks Act, 1999 (‘Trademarks Act’) cannot be held to be an act of abandonment, particularly when the Act does not prescribe any time limit for the filing of such an application, and even the time limit of three months prescribed under section 124(1) (b) (ii) of the Act begins only once the court concerned has framed an additional issue as provided thereunder
